Musical Impact

This year, the Somerset Hills Chorus has gathered singers from across the region for inspiring performances that bring audiences together in joy, reflection, and celebration. Summer Voices welcomed young singers in grades 2–12, giving them the chance to grow their skills, build confidence, and make lasting friendships through music.​

Our educational offerings now span early childhood classes, summer programs, and scholarship support, ensuring that students at every stage can access high-quality musical experiences. Less than half of our annual expenses are covered by ticket sales and program fees, so these programs are only possible because of donors like you.​

MISH in the Schools

This year, MISH in the Schools has begun partnering with public high school choral programs throughout Somerset County. Teaching artists and clinicians are also partnering with local choir directors to provide mentorship, workshops, and high-level musical experiences directly in students’ classrooms. All of this is offered at no cost to schools or districts!​

Our mission is to create musical experiences of the highest quality for those who live and work in the Somerset Hills and its surroundings. Founded on the belief that music can transport us and enhance the quality of life within communities, we work to curate performances and educational opportunities that positively impact the lives of people from all walks of life.
